[Pce] Experimental Codepoint allocation in PCEP registry

2016-06-09 Thread Dhruv Dhody
Hi WG, In PCE IANA registry [http://www.iana.org/assignments/pcep] we do not have any codepoints for experimental usage. As we work on some new experiments with PCEP (sometimes in open source platform), it would be wise to use experimental codepoints to avoid any conflict. For this purpose we
